Inhibition of human immunodeficiency virus type 1 reverse transcriptase activity by cordatolides isolated from Calophyllum cordato-oblongum.

Abstract:

:Cordatolide A and B were re-isolated from Calophyllum cordato-oblongum, an endemic species of Sri Lanka, and found to inhibit HIV-1 reverse transcriptase with IC50 values of 12.3 and 19.0 microM, respectively.
